The table below shows the values of the relation \(y = 11 - 2x - 2x^{2}\) for \(-4 \leq x \leq 3\).

x -4 -3 -2 -1 0 1 2 3
y -13       11      

(a) Copy and complete the table.

(b) Using a scale of 2 cm to 1 unit on the x- axis and 2 cm to 5 units on the y- axis, draw the graph of \(y = 11 - 2x - 2x^{2}\).

(c) Use your graph to find : (i) the roots of the equation \(11 - 2x - 2x^{2} = 0\) ; (ii) the values of x for which \(3 - 2x - 2x^{2} = 0\) ; (iii) the gradient of the curve at x = 1.
